What you’re getting

This is a 4-camera wireless security system built around convenience and range. The standout features are the two-year battery life claim and the extended wireless range, with up to 1000 feet open-air range (or around 400 feet with typical use).

That matters because placement is usually where camera systems get annoying. If you’ve got a detached garage, a longer driveway, or a larger yard, range can be the difference between “works great” and “constant headaches.”

A four-camera kit also gives you flexibility right away. You can cover the obvious spots first, then move things around as you learn where your blind spots are.
